Proven Cow Families

7321Thomas Lady 7321

The “power” family here at Thomas Angus Ranch has long been the Lady family. Thomas Lady 7321 is featured in the Southern Cattle Company program and excels with an ultrasound record of %IMF 78@102, UREA 78@101, Fat 78@95 and RFat 78@98 and also has nearly $250,000 in progeny sales for Thomas Angus Ranch. Together with her full sister, Thomas Lady Jet 4394 who has WR 6@101, YR 6@105, %IMF 55@100 and UREA 55@102, they have produced some of the most powerful females in our program.

Daughters of 7321 include the $65,000 valued Thomas Lady 3766 featured at Deer Valley along with her $29,000 full sister Thomas Lady 2740, the $21,000 Thomas Lady 4781 featured in the Werner Angus program, the $19,000 Thomas Lady 3743 at Claylick Run in Ohio, the $15,250 Brookfield donor Thomas Lady 3744 and many more females working in prominent programs around the country. In addition, a daughter, Thomas Lady 2735, who is now deceased, has left behind many great daughters in our program who have gone on to be sale features.

Daughters of 4394 are currently working in the Trowbridge Angus, Dunford Royal, Ellingson and Mountain Meadow programs.

Thomas Lady 3766

Co-owned with Deer Valley, this great Twin Valley Precision E161 daughter excels with WR 1@113, YR 1@108 and %IMF 12@111. She produced our top-selling bull in the spring of 2006 to Claylick Run and Fred Penick, and two of her daughters were selected by Deer Valley to further propagate these elite carcass genetics.

2675Thomas Lady Jet 2675

One of the breed’s most powerful GAR Precision 1680 daughters produced from Thomas Lady Jet 4394. She will sell as a highlight of the 2007 Trowbridge Angus Sale and has already produced daughters working in the Nardelli and Deer Valley programs and sons sold as features of our Spring 2007 Bull Sale to top commercial cattlemen with one son selling to the performance program at Canyon Creek Ranch in Wyoming.
